Description
In a world where myth and magic intertwine, a young man’s journey takes him to the edge of discovery and danger. As Kvothe continues to unravel the mysteries of his past, he finds himself facing challenges that are as daunting as they are enlightening. With each encounter, he learns more about the complex tapestry of life and the burdens that wisdom often carries.
Friendships blossom, but so do rivalries, and the lines between reality and legend blur in unexpected ways. Kvothe’s escapades draw readers into a realm where courage and cleverness are tested at every turn. His narrative weaves through thrilling, heart-pounding moments and quiet introspection, painting a vivid picture of a hero in the making.
As secrets unfold and truths come to light, the stakes rise higher. It becomes clear that understanding the world is a double-edged sword. This chapter of Kvothe’s saga is a mesmerizing blend of adventure, emotion, and philosophical musings, inviting readers to ponder the nature of fear and the price of knowledge.
